You are dealt one card from a deck of 52 cards find the probability that you are dealt a 5 or a black card is answered in fractions. simplify.

There are 52 cards in a deck.

There are 4 fives in the deck.
There are 26 black cards in the deck.

The probability of being dealt a 5 or a black card is given by:

Probability = (Number of favorable outcomes)/(Total number of possible outcomes)

Number of favorable outcomes = number of fives + number of black cards - number of fives that are black (to avoid double-counting)

Number of favorable outcomes = 4 + 26 - 2 (there are 2 fives that are black)

Number of favorable outcomes = 28

Total number of possible outcomes = 52

Probability = 28/52

Probability = 7/13

So, the probability of being dealt a 5 or a black card is 7/13.
